What the Evidence Says

AI-generated · Qwen 3.6 · methodology

This blend contains red vine and licorice, which have limited evidence for supporting vascular health and fluid balance. Other components like black walnut and horsetail are traditionally used for detoxification and diuretic effects. Overall, clinical research for this specific combination of ingredients is limited.
